Anybody have any first hand experience shooting 105 gr amax on hogs? It has worked great on deer and coyotes out to extended ranges. First time going hog hunting and I have a couple hundred of these loaded up. I can obviously load something else but I these will work then I will use them . Any experience would be appreciated.
 
I think you would be better of with SST than AMAX. AMAX tends to perform in an inconsistent manner when dealing with animals such as hogs. It can work very well. It can also be a poor performer.

For smaller hogs, you should be fine. It would be with BIG hogs that you are most apt to have issues.
